    Comprehending SCHD

    Before diving into the annual dividend estimation, let's briefly discuss what schd dividend payout calculator is. The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F is crafted to track the performance of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. It consists mostly of high dividend yielding U.S. stocks that have a record of consistently paying dividends. SCHD intends to offer a high level of income while likewise providing opportunities for capital gratitude.

    Secret Features of SCHD

    1. Dividend Focus: SCHD highlights stocks that not only pay dividends however have a record of increasing their payments.
    2. Affordable: With a reasonably low expenditure ratio, SCHD is an effective way to get direct exposure to dividend-paying U.S. equities.
    3. Diversified Portfolio: The ETF holds a well-diversified set of securities throughout numerous sectors, decreasing risk compared to individual stocks.

    How to Calculate Annual Dividends from SCHD

    Estimating your annual dividends from SCHD involves inputting a couple of variables into a dividend calculator. The main variables usually consist of:

    1. Number of shares owned: The total SCHD shares you own.
    2. Present dividend per share: The most current stated dividend.
    3. Dividend frequency: Typically, dividends for SCHD are paid quarterly.

    Formula for Annual Dividend Calculation

    The formula to calculate your annual dividends is fairly uncomplicated:

    [\ text Annual Dividends = \ text Variety Of Shares Owned \ times \ text Dividends per Share \ times \ text Dividend Frequency]

    Example Calculation

    Let's take a look at the annual dividends using an example. Suppose a financier owns 100 shares of SCHD and the most current dividend per share is ₤ 1.25. The dividend is distributed quarterly (4 times a year).

    ParameterValue
    Number of Shares Owned100
    Current Dividend per Share₤ 1.25
    Dividend Frequency (per year)4

    Utilizing our formula, we can calculate:

    [\ text Annual Dividends = 100 \ times 1.25 \ times 4 = 500]

    In this case, the investor would receive ₤ 500 in annual dividends from owning 100 shares of schd dividend time frame.

    The Importance of Reinvesting Dividends

    While getting dividend payments is rewarding, consider reinvesting them through a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RIP). This strategy permits financiers to buy additional shares of SCHD utilizing the dividends got, possibly compounding their returns in time.

    Advantages of Dividend Reinvestment

    1. Substance Growth: Reinvesting can substantially increase investment returns.
    2. Dollar-Cost Averaging: Regularly purchasing shares causes lower average costs in time.
    3. Increased Holdings: This leads to higher future dividends as you collect more shares.

    Projecting Future Earnings

    To assist investor decision-making, think about using an SCHD annual dividend calculator or spreadsheet. These tools can allow you to predict future earnings based upon different growth situations.

    Elements to Consider in Projections

    1. Historic Dividend Growth Rate: Review SCHD's historical dividend increases when forecasting future payouts.
    2. Investment Horizon: Longer financial investment durations can substantially impact the total returns.
    3. Market Fluctuations: Best practices involve accounting for potential market volatility.

    Sample Projection Table

    YearShares OwnedDividend per ShareEstimated Annual Dividends
    1100₤ 1.25₤ 500
    2103₤ 1.30₤ 533
    3106₤ 1.35₤ 569
    4109₤ 1.40₤ 607
    5112₤ 1.45₤ 645

    Presumptions: 3% annual growth in shares due to reinvestment, 4% growth in dividends per share

    Frequently Asked Questions about SCHD Annual Dividend Calculator

    1. How do I discover the current dividend per share for SCHD?
    You can find the existing dividend per share for SCHD on monetary news websites, brokerage platforms, or the official Schwab website.

    2. Can I estimate future dividends with certainty?
    While you can make estimates based on historical information and growth rates, future dividends can be affected by many aspects such as financial conditions, business performance, and market patterns.

    3. What takes place if schd dividend calculator cuts its dividend?
    If SCHD were to cut its dividend, this would significantly minimize the income generated from your investment, and modifications in your computation would be required.

    4. Is SCHD appropriate for long-term holding?
    SCHD is typically considered appropriate for long-lasting financiers due to its concentrate on capital growth and dividend income, however personal financial investment objectives and run the risk of tolerance needs to assist decisions.

    5. Can I utilize the SCHD annual dividend calculator for other ETFs?
    Yes, the very same calculator principles can be applied to other dividend-paying ETFs or stocks, though you would require the particular dividend rates for each.
